具体实施方式detailed description
为使本实用新型的目的、技术方案和优点更加清楚,下面将结合附图对本实用新型实施方式作进一步地详细描述。In order to make the purpose, technical solutions and advantages of the present utility model clearer, the implementation of the present utility model will be further described in detail below in conjunction with the accompanying drawings.
如图1所示,在本实用新型的SIM卡无缝铳切装置第一实施例中,该铳切装置1包括铳切机2、以及设置于该铳切机2下方的传送装置3,该铳切机2包括用于上下往复运动的铳切柱4、用于带动该铳切柱4往复运动的气压装置5或液压装置、固定设置于该铳切柱4底端的固定模具6、以及固设于该固定模具6底端的框刀7,该框刀7表面凸出于该固定模具6底面,该传送装置3包括环形传送带8、以及带动该环形传送带8转动的至少一个传送齿轮12,该环形传送带8内侧设有与该传送齿轮12配合的链条9,该传送装置3还包括垫设于该环形传送带8底部的支撑垫板10,该支撑垫板10上设有供该链条9穿出与该传送齿轮12啮合的通槽,该固定模具6上设有至少两个用于与该铳切柱4固定连接的第一固定孔,该固定模具6底面设有供该框刀7插入卡合连接的容置槽,该环形传送带8表面固设有用于放置SIM卡14的复数个固定框11,该复数个固定框11中每相邻两个固定框11之间的距离相同。As shown in Figure 1, in the first embodiment of the SIM card seamless gun-cutting device of the present utility model, the gun-cutting device 1 includes a gun-cutting machine 2 and a conveying device 3 arranged below the gun-cutting machine 2, the The gun-cutting machine 2 includes a gun-cut column 4 for reciprocating up and down, an air pressure device 5 or a hydraulic device for driving the gun-cut column 4 to reciprocate, a fixed mold 6 fixedly arranged at the bottom of the gun-cut column 4, and a fixed The frame knife 7 that is located at the bottom of the fixed mold 6, the surface of the frame knife 7 protrudes from the bottom surface of the fixed mold 6, the transmission device 3 includes an endless conveyor belt 8, and at least one transmission gear 12 that drives the endless conveyor belt 8 to rotate. The inner side of the endless conveyor belt 8 is provided with a chain 9 cooperating with the transmission gear 12. The transmission device 3 also includes a support pad 10 placed on the bottom of the endless conveyor belt 8. The support pad 10 is provided with a chain 9 for the chain 9 to pass through The through groove meshed with the transmission gear 12, the fixed mold 6 is provided with at least two first fixing holes for fixed connection with the blasting column 4, and the bottom surface of the fixed mold 6 is provided with the frame knife 7 inserted into the card The accommodating grooves connected together, the surface of the endless conveyor belt 8 is fixed with a plurality of fixed frames 11 for placing SIM cards 14, and the distance between every two adjacent fixed frames 11 in the plurality of fixed frames 11 is the same.
使用本实用新型的SIM卡无缝铳切装置1时,可将需要铳切的SIM卡14放置于环形传送带8的固定框11内,然后控制传送齿轮12转动带动环形传送带8转动,与此同时,控制气压装置5或液压装置带动铳切柱4进行上下往复运动,铳切柱4带动固定模具6及框刀7上下往复运动,致使框刀7与固定框11内的SIM卡14进行接触,并对SIM卡14进行铳切,达到自动化铳切SIM卡14的效果。When using the SIM card seamless cutting device 1 of the present utility model, the SIM card 14 that needs to be cut can be placed in the fixed frame 11 of the endless conveyor belt 8, and then the transmission gear 12 is controlled to rotate to drive the endless conveyor belt 8 to rotate, and at the same time , control the air pressure device 5 or the hydraulic device to drive the gun cutting column 4 to reciprocate up and down, and the gun cutting column 4 drives the fixed mold 6 and the frame knife 7 to reciprocate up and down, so that the frame knife 7 contacts the SIM card 14 in the fixed frame 11, And the SIM card 14 is cut to achieve the effect of cutting the SIM card 14 automatically.
进一步的,该框刀7内设有用于检测该框刀7水平度的水平传感器,该铳切机2内设有与该水平传感器电连接的控制芯片,该铳切机2表面设有与该控制芯片电连接、并用于显示水平度数据的显示屏。Further, the frame knife 7 is provided with a level sensor for detecting the levelness of the frame knife 7, the gun cutter 2 is provided with a control chip electrically connected to the level sensor, and the gun cutter 2 is provided with a The control chip is electrically connected and used to display the display screen of level data.
进一步的,该容置槽第一侧边设有第一螺纹通孔,该第一螺纹通孔内设有与该第一螺纹通孔螺接、并在该框刀7插入至该容置槽内时抵接该框刀7外侧面的第一螺栓,该容置槽第二侧边设有第二螺纹通孔,该第二螺纹通孔内设有与该第二螺纹通孔螺接、并在该框刀7插入至该容置槽内时抵接该框刀7外侧面的第二螺栓。Further, the first side of the accommodation groove is provided with a first threaded through hole, and the first threaded through hole is provided with a threaded hole that is screwed into the first threaded through hole and inserted into the accommodation groove when the frame knife 7 is inserted into the accommodation groove. Abut against the first bolt on the outer surface of the frame knife 7 when inside, the second side of the accommodation groove is provided with a second threaded through hole, and the second threaded through hole is provided with a threaded connection with the second threaded through hole, And abut against the second bolt on the outer surface of the frame knife 7 when the frame knife 7 is inserted into the accommodating groove.
进一步的,该传送齿轮12还包括用于带动该传送齿轮12转动的传送伺服电机13,可以理解的,该传送伺服电机13可以在转动第一时间段后停止转动,并在停止第二时间段后继续转动第一时间段长度,进行间隔运动。也就是说,当传送伺服电机13带动固定框11移动至框刀7下方时,停止第二时间段长度,供框刀7进行铳切,在停止第二时间段后,继续转动第一时间段长度,带动下一个固定框11移动至框刀7下方,如此循环。Further, the transmission gear 12 also includes a transmission servo motor 13 for driving the transmission gear 12 to rotate. It can be understood that the transmission servo motor 13 can stop rotating after a first period of time, and stop for a second time period. After that, continue to rotate the length of the first time period, and perform interval movement. That is to say, when the transmission servo motor 13 drives the fixed frame 11 to move below the frame knife 7, the length of the second period of time is stopped for the frame knife 7 to perform guncutting. After stopping the second period of time, continue to rotate for the first period of time length, drives the next fixed frame 11 to move to below the frame knife 7, and so on.
